Household of Alex Rustone (born 1799, Fife)

1881 England, Wales & Scotland Census in Kennoway, Fife, Scotland

The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Alex Rustone, born in 1799 in Wemyss, Fife, consisted of 3 members. Alex was the head of the household, widower. He had 1 child; Jane, born 1837 in Kennoway, Fife, Scotland.
During the period, also present in the household was Alex's Grandson, John Rustone, born in 1871 in Lasswade, Midlothian, Scotland.
